S. Korea's fiscal deficit narrows to multi-year low in H1 on robust tax revenue
South Korea's fiscal deficit narrowed to a multi-year low in the first half on the back of robust tax revenue, government data showed Thursday.The consolidated fiscal balance, or gross revenue minus gross expenditure, posted a deficit of 43.9 trillion won (31.0 billion U.S. dollars) in the January-June period, down from 68.6 trillion won (48.4 billion dollars) in the same period of last year, according to the Ministry of Planning and Budget.
